Transaction 63f4a13679a378ca23e991785aad6b646ec60236d20578aca445b4af7732d80a

2 Input
2 Outputs
  • 63f4a13679a378ca23e991785aad6b646ec60236d20578aca445b4af7732d80a:0
  • value  11637
    address  13tt7TEanXe92TB4eTuZynG8ojvU79JmVK
  • 63f4a13679a378ca23e991785aad6b646ec60236d20578aca445b4af7732d80a:1
  • value  3662958
    address  38RQfFgkF87YadXRnGVpB3H5bbzkKpBgRQ